Which of the following statements about Young's modulus is correct?

A

Young's modulus is the ratio of tensile stress to tensile strain in the elastic limit.

B

Young's modulus is only applicable to materials that can be permanently deformed.

C

Young's modulus measures the compressive strength of a material under load.

D

Young's modulus is the same for all materials regardless of their properties.

Correct Answer

Option A

Detailed Explanation

Young's modulus is defined as the ratio of tensile stress to tensile strain within the elastic limit, which is a critical aspect of the material's response to deformation as mentioned in the NCERT context.
